Wall-Mounted
A TV media wall with an electric fire built in is a chic and elegant way to add an ambiance of flickering light to your living room. These combo units provide an elegant design and plenty of storage space for your set-top box, TV DVD players, and video games. They can also hide the wiring for your electric fireplace, providing an elegant and tidy look to your entertainment area.

You can pick from a wide range of sizes for wall-mounted electric fireplaces. Some of them are fully recessible into the wall to allow to ensure a seamless installation, while others have a raised mantel that creates a sense of depth to your room. You can also choose whether to go with a traditional gas-effect fireplace or opt for one with an amazing LED flame effect that replicates the appearance of real flames.
A majority of these electric fires have additional features like a thermostat remote control, timer and remote function that makes them suitable for use at home. Some models have an automatic safety shut-off feature in the event that the device is tripped by heat. You can also find units with an entertainment shelf that can conceal the TV's cables and wires and wires, providing you with an integrated solution that is easy to keep clean.
They are simple to set up but require some specialist skills and tools to set up. A wall-mounted recessed fire for instance, would require mounting brackets to be put into the wall, which could mean cutting into the drywall. They will also need to be hardwired in an outlet. This may require an expert installation.
The main drawback of wall-mounted fire places is that they are usually installed at eye level. This means you can’t mount a television above them without compromising viewing height. This can pose a challenge for guests or children who might desire to touch the fireplace.

A majority of people are looking for a lot of things when they're shopping for the perfect fireplace TV stand, including dimensions of the stand, heat output, setting storage options, and the appearance of the fireplace itself. TV stands and fireplaces that are integrated come in many different sizes to fit most types of TVs and are available in a range of materials, from the classic wood finishes that work well in traditional homes to modern metal designs that feature glass surfaces that are tempered to look chic and sophisticated.
These stands allow you to keep all your media equipment at one place. They also provide plenty of space for other equipment like DVD players, gaming systems and sound systems. Certain models have cable management features that keep wires in order and out of sight. Furthermore, the majority of models are plug-and-play, so you don't have to hire an electrician expert or build a chimney.
The biggest downside of TV stands with an electric fireplace is that it doesn't usually have the same space as an ordinary stand, particularly those designed for larger televisions. Many of these units are made from inferior materials like engineered wood, with laminated top. It looks fake at first, and it begins to swell and peel in the corners in a couple of short years.
